MT17 HYH is a 2017 Kia Venga in Silver with a 1,591c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.9%.
Across all 2017 Kia Venga models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.9% with a typical mileage of 26,455 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Venga f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 4,040 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MT17 HYH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Venga typ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 9 years old, this Kia Venga is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
